Yesterday afternoon reports came in about a robocall attacking Ward 1 Councilmember Jim Graham. The call was anonymous, with no message indicating who was behind it or who financed it. Last night TBD posted the audio of the call, which features a woman’s voice telling the listener that Jim Graham paid for an abortion for his chief of staff’s girlfriend. The narrator then goes on to describe Graham as “immoral” and “wretched.”
The Graham campaign has contacted the Metropolitan Police Department, the Federal Communications Commission and the Federal Bureau of Investigation. According to Graham spokesperson Chuck Thies, the call likely violated federal law which requires automated calls to identify their source and purpose.
Both of Jim Graham’s Democratic challengers have denied any involvement with the call. Bryan Weaver said via email “[n]either my campaign, nor anyone affiliated with my campaign had anything to do with these phone calls. I find them as disgusting as everyone else and its unfortunate that whoever is doing this couldn’t just let the race be run and won on the issues.” Jeff Smith also stated his campaign had nothing to do with the call.
Marc Morgan, the Republican candidate for the Ward 1 seat, stated “we had absolutely nothing to do with it.” Morgan acknowledged that the very pro-life content of the call could cause people to point fingers at the GOP candidate. “Whoever was behind it should own up to it and apologize,” said Morgan. Morgan says his campaign is dedicated to “covering the issues” and that they are not interested in delving into negativity.
